During the latest party and skins crash a week or so ago I had eight 215s running, 4 on empire and 4 on eurobet. I was disconnected on three of my empire games with the fourth still running.

I logged out of empire to try to log back in and restore connectivity since that sometimes works but instead I was unable to log back in and consequently got blinded off in all four tournaments.

They refunded the three that were having problems but won't even acknowledge the fourth one is their fault.

Below are the email correspondensces thus far, what do you think I should do and where can I take this so that people will listen?

I am a royalflush club member at empire and have given them well over $20k in rake in the last 4-5 months.

I have edited the emails for readability only, the ones I sent appear in bold. They appear in reverse order so start at the bottom.

while empire's total lack to understand the situation here is frustrating I do think the poster's tone got pretty nasty VERY quickly.

asking them things like 'are you saying that I actually like being disconnected?' is not going to help them understand what you are saying.

you have to continually repeat that the reason you were disconnected from the 4th one is because you were trying to get back to the 3 others ones.

"I had to log-out of empire because of my disconnect on the 3 other one's. When I logged out it would not let me log back on. This wasn't my fault and it wasn't the ISP. It was because Empire was experiencing difficulties at the time. I was playing 4 SNG's at once....and 3 of them went down. So I HAD to log-out to try toget the 3 other one's to work again. But when I did.....I was just shut out completely."

etc etc.

"If the other 3 hadn't gotten disconnected I would never have had to log-off the client in the first place. It wouldn't let me back on!! I tried and I tried....and my internet-connection was fine.
The problem came when I had 3 other tables go out on me and I HAD to log-off."


blah blah blah.


Mentioning stuff like open-folding AQ and 99 is just arguing the wrong point and will confuse them and lead them to say "we can see that you were having difficulties with your connection."

Pick the ONE point and stick to it and repeat it over and over until they actually get it.


Yup....they're pretty dumb.
I'm not positive this is the right tactic to take. But I think it might have a better chance of sinking in with them.
